Why Is My Car Hard To Start When Warm?

A car can be hard to start when warm due to several issues. A defective crankshaft or camshaft position sensor may miscommunicate with the ECU. A clogged air filter restricts airflow, impacting performance. Vapor lock can occur, preventing fuel from reaching the engine. Additionally, faulty battery connections and bad engine ground connections can hinder electricity flow. Each of these problems requires attention to guarantee reliable engine performance. Defective Crankshaft or Camshaft Position Sensor

The crankshaft and camshaft position sensors play an essential role in engine performance by monitoring the rotation of these components and relaying critical information to the engine control unit (ECU).

When these sensors become defective, miscommunication can occur, particularly when the engine is hot. Symptoms of a faulty sensor include the illumination of the Check Engine Light, engine backfires, and unusual vibrations.

Internal circuitry may expand with heat, causing intermittent issues that may resolve upon cooling. This leads to a scenario where the engine starts normally when cold but struggles when warm, indicating a need for sensor inspection or replacement.

Clogged Air Filter

A clogged air filter can greatly impact engine performance, compounding issues caused by faulty sensors. When the air filter becomes obstructed, airflow to the combustion chamber is considerably reduced.

This restriction leads to diminished engine performance, resulting in symptoms such as misfiring and poor fuel economy. Additionally, debris buildup in the filter can cause decreased acceleration, making it harder for the engine to respond promptly.

Regular maintenance often overlooks the air filter, but cleaning or replacing it can restore ideal airflow, enhancing overall performance and ensuring smoother operation when the engine is warm.

Vapor Lock

Vapor lock is a condition that can greatly hinder a vehicle's ability to start when warm, particularly in hot weather. This phenomenon occurs when fuel vaporizes in the fuel lines before reaching the combustion chamber, often exacerbated by elevated temperatures.

Factors such as poorly insulated fuel lines positioned near the hot engine can contribute to this problem. Symptoms of vapor lock include difficulty starting the engine and potential stalling once started.

A temporary solution involves cooling the fuel lines with ice, which can help restore fuel flow and improve starting performance until a more permanent fix is applied.

Faulty Battery Connection

Electrical issues can often arise from faulty battery connections, considerably impacting a vehicle's starting ability when warm.

Over time, battery movement can lead to loosened connections, while corrosion may further diminish electrical conductivity. These issues tend to exacerbate when the engine is hot, as increased resistance can hinder the flow of electricity.

Consequently, the vehicle may experience difficulty starting and struggle with the operation of electrical accessories.

Regular inspection and maintenance of battery connections are essential to prevent such problems, ensuring reliable performance and a smoother starting experience, particularly in warmer conditions.

Bad Engine Ground Connection

Issues related to battery connections can often lead to broader electrical problems, including those stemming from bad engine ground connections. A loose or corroded ground connection can markedly increase circuit resistance, causing erratic electrical behavior in the starting system.

This can result in difficulty starting the engine, especially when it is warm. Additionally, other components, such as the transmission, may also be affected by poor grounding.

Voltage drop tests are effective for identifying grounding issues, making proper maintenance of ground connections essential for ideal vehicle performance and reliability. Regular inspections can prevent starting difficulties and enhance overall functionality.

Are There Specific Symptoms of a Failing Starter Motor?

A failing starter motor typically presents symptoms such as grinding noises, intermittent starting issues, a clicking sound when turning the key, or the engine not cranking altogether, indicating potential electrical or mechanical failures within the component.

How Can I Test for Vapor Lock in My Vehicle?

To test for vapor lock, one can check for symptoms like difficulty starting and stalling. Cooling the fuel lines with ice or observing fuel delivery issues during hot conditions can help diagnose this problem effectively.
